django-custom-tags

    1熱度

    2回答

    我已經寫了包含標籤,它需要上下文和*指定參數和** kwargs @register.inclusion_tag('template.html', takes_context=True) def my_tag(a, b, *args, **kwargs): print 'Kwargs: ' return ..... 模板: {% my_tag 1 1 2 page=10

    -1熱度

    1回答

    我有一個模型樹,並使用模型遞歸渲染自己使用自定義模板標記。 每個Widget模型都擁有模板和上下文數據,並且可以自行渲染。 控件可能有子控件模型,子控件將首先渲染,父控件可以組裝它們。 而模板使用自定義標籤。 型號代碼 class Widget(models.Model): slug = models.SlugField(max_length=255, unique=True) title =

    1熱度

    2回答

    文件結構: _project_ __init__.py settings/ __init__.py settings.py apps/ __init__.py newapp/ __init__.py models.py .... templatetags/

    1熱度

    1回答

    我有一個base.html由所有其他頁面繼承。並且所有頁面的頁腳也來自base.html 現在我想在頁腳中顯示來自db的一些對象。所以我需要將一些對象從db渲染到base.html。然後我想,我會寫我自己的標籤來完成這項工作。 我這樣做自定義標籤: def berlin_tag(): loc_berlin = Location.objects.filter(stadt="Berlin")

    1熱度

    1回答

    我遇到問題。我寫了一個自定義模板標籤中包含這個 - def has_paid_for_article(article, request): 函數簽名現在,在我的模板標籤我有一個條件語句來確定用戶是否可以下載一篇文章或沒有(這是確定是否該文章超過兩年或登錄用戶已爲文章付費)。這裏的snippet- {% if article|is_older_than_two_years %} <span c

    1熱度

    1回答

    我正在寫一個自定義模板標籤,用一些代碼來包裝HTML元素以使其可編輯。這由一些CSS和JS來支持,負責將數據發送到服務器以保存它。 此組件需要在頁面底部列入 <script type="text/javascript" src="../myscript.js"></script> 和 <link rel="stylesheet" type="text/css" href="../mystyle

    0熱度

    1回答

    執行檢查以查看用戶是否參加。如何將上下文變量is_attending傳遞給模板而不會在'is_attending': context['is_attending']上發生語法錯誤?該檢查基本上是爲造型div和whatnot。我究竟做錯了什麼? 模板: {% for event in upcoming %} {% registration %} {% if is_attendi

    0熱度

    1回答

    我正在創建一個自定義標籤,我必須通過多個參數。我可以做與args,分離列表,但我面臨的問題,同時傳遞在列表中的對象。 def mytag(id,args): 而我會調用它,在上述情況下通過ARGS像這樣的HTML {% for image in images %} {{ image.pk|mytag:"100,100"}} {% endfor %} I M通過pk和100,10

    0熱度

    1回答

    如果我把在Django template.html這個代碼 <p>{% if some_custom_template %} {%some_custom_template%} {% else %} nothing {% endif %}</p> 將some_custom_template執行兩次?或者some_custom_template結果被緩衝? 如果some_custom_template

    0熱度

    2回答

    我有這樣的模型在Django: News Comments Reactions 的關係是: a News has various Comments a Comment has various Reactions 問題是用戶(在請求/會話):用戶可以訂閱反應或評論;他可能會登錄或不登錄。 (這是一個foo的例子,它並沒有多大意義) 我不能在模板做: {% for reaction in